Biographical Sketch

After interning at The New York Hospital, he was assigned to active duty in the Naval Medical Corps at St. Albans Naval Hospital, then at the U.S. Naval Academy. He was a research fellow in Physiology in Rochester, N.Y. with Dr. Wallace O. Fenn, then a senior assistant resident in Medicine at the Peter Bent Brigham Hospital in Boston. He moved to Philadelphia in 1952 to work with Dr. Julius H. Comroe, Jr., and later Robert E. Forster, M.D., moving up from Assistant Professor to Professor of Physiology and Medicine. From 1974 to 1988 he was Director of the John B. Pierce Foundation Laboratory in New Haven, CT, where he presently continues as Fellow, with appointments as Professor of Epidemiology and Physiology at Yale Medical School.
